Think back to the last team project you participated in at work. How did the person running the project lead the group? Did they lead by presenting a plan and using their authority to insist that others follow along? Or did the person instead lead by explaining why a particular course of action seemed like the best one, allowing others to willfully get on board?
Good Bosses Switch Between Two Leadership Styles
Some situations call for dominance, and others call for prestige.
